Top Sights of Rome

When exploring the captivating city of Rome, visitors are drawn to its top sights that showcase the rich history and mesmerizing beauty of this ancient city.
One of the must-visit attractions is the Colosseum, an iconic symbol of Rome’s grandeur and architectural prowess. This historical landmark, once a gladiatorial arena, stands as a testament to the city’s imperial past.
Another top sight is the Vatican City, home to St. Peter’s Basilica and the Sistine Chapel. These stunning examples of Renaissance art and architecture attract millions of visitors each year.
For those interested in ancient ruins, the Roman Forum offers a glimpse into the daily life of ancient Rome, with its crumbling temples, basilicas, and government buildings.
These top sights and historical landmarks provide a glimpse into the rich tapestry of Rome’s past, making it a truly unforgettable destination.

Famous Piazzas and Landmarks

Travelers on a private tour of Rome can enjoy the history and beauty of the city as they visit its famous piazzas and landmarks. These iconic sites hold great historical significance and are must-see attractions for any visitor to the Eternal City.
| Famous Piazzas | Historical Significance | Hidden Gems |
|---|---|---|
| Piazza Navona | Built on the site of the Stadium of Domitian, this bustling square is adorned with beautiful fountains, including Bernini’s famous Fountain of the Four Rivers. | Discover the hidden church of Sant’Agnese in Agone, tucked away behind the square, and admire its stunning Baroque architecture. |
| Piazza di Spagna | Known for the Spanish Steps and the charming Fontana della Barcaccia, this square is a popular gathering place and offers breathtaking views of the city. | Take a stroll down the nearby Via Margutta, a picturesque street known for its art galleries and boutiques. |
| Piazza del Popolo | Translating to "People’s Square," this piazza is home to the ancient Flaminian Obelisk and surrounded by beautiful churches and palaces. | Explore the hidden gardens of Villa Borghese, just a short walk from the square, and enjoy a peaceful escape from the bustling city. |
These famous piazzas are just a glimpse of the wonders that await on a private tour of Rome. Whether it’s the historical significance or the hidden gems, there’s something for all to discover in the Eternal City.

What Is the Dress Code for Places of Worship and Selected Museums?
The dress code for places of worship and selected museums in Rome emphasizes cultural appropriateness and modest attire. Visitors are expected to dress respectfully, covering their shoulders and knees out of respect for the religious and historical significance of these sites.
